resistance range for picoboard?
Hi,
Does anyone know what resistance range is detectable from the picoboard alligator clips? I would like to interface a bend sensor that varies from 25K to 125K ohms and wondered if the board will report that.

resistance range for picoboard?
They have a 10k pull up to 5V, your sensor goes from the bottom of the 10K to 0V (by the clips) to form a potential divider. The picoboard then uses an ADC on the centre junction voltage.
So you should be able to get something useful from your sensor.
